Dermatopathology Fellowship 

The Department of Pathology and Laboratory Medicine offers one-year accredited fellowships that provide intensive training in all aspects of dermatopathology to prepare trainees for an academic or community career in the field.  Fellows trained in dermatology do an ACGME-approved combination of months of dermatopatholgy and months of pathology with an emphasis on those fields most relevant to dermatopathology.  Fellows trained in AP or AP/CP likewise do a combination of dermatopathology months and months at UCLA's prestigious Dermatology Clinic.  All fellows are provided with the highest level of dermatopathology training including daily sign-out of many extremely challenging consult cases and a high volume of routine cases from community dermatologists and the hospital's inpatients.  A broad range of ancillary studies including immunohistochemistry and molecular pathology are routinely employed by the service.  Extensive opportunities for basic, translational, and clinical research are available including collaborations with UCLA professors studying a wide spectrum of clinical and basic science disciplines.  Educational opportunities are limitless.  Three fellowship positions are available beginning July 1, 2008.

Requirements: Board eligible in AP, AP/CP, or dermatology.  A California Medical license is required.
